Posted: Thu Jan 16, 2025 15:49 Post subject: MX43000 New flash, no RX data on WIFI, no static or DHCP
It is probably something super simple, but I am banging my head on this one.
MX4300. Works fine on Factory, and OpenWRT. On DD-WRT WIFI connects, but no data...
Tried a couple builds, currently
v3.0-r59156 std
New flash, All Defaults, no WIFI Security or any changes at all!
Wired works fine, and can connect to wifi dd-wrt SSID on multiple radieos, but get no DHCP and end up with self assigned 169.254, and setting static IP to 192.168.1.3 does not permit ping of 192.168.1.1
WIFI status shows devices connected to multiple radios and packets sent but none received.
It is like inbound packets are just being dropped???
Reset and try again but DO use wifi security. Some AX routers are not working w/dhcp when security is disabled. _________________ - Linksys EA8500: I-Gateway, WAP/VAP 5ghz only. Features: VLANs, Samba, WG, Entware - r60xxx
